2 hours ago, Subby1938 said:

Is this issue scarce ? 

Not especially, at least according to the CGC census data. Sub-Mariner #7 may be uncommon, but with 25 universal copies and 9 restored (34 total, assuming no duplicate resubmissions), several of which are high grade, scarcity would probably be considered a borderline case based on demand and availability.  That’s just my 2 cents (other’s mileage may vary, as all Subbies are desirable books).

On 6/18/2020 at 11:39 PM, Subby1938 said:

One thing I’m really learning is respect in trying to collect these . I’m totally understanding the difficulty in obtaining and buying at a decent price is not an easy task.

I knew from the start I would be on lower end of collecting Subby’s I wanted to stay in 2-4.0 range but my goal is no restored books. So far so good .

The difficult part is accepting that even with money in hand finding a particular issue is not like Silver Age era and beyond. You have to get in line and wait . When one does come up it’s eye opening how fast and expensive a book can rocket up. The other point I wanted to make is not all issues exist in low grades. I have a cgc census from last year I printed off to use as a guide on issues I’m after and what’s been graded . Some books exist only above 3.0 or more which puts me in more pricey buy in and more competitive bracket to obtain these . 

Im learning and having fun collecting these . It’s been most rewarding for me over any other period as it also feeds my urge for the hunt!
